The alarming decline of water levels in Lake Powell, now at their lowest recorded point, serves as a stark reminder of the ongoing water crisis affecting millions across the western United States. This situation, compounded by prolonged drought and climate change, threatens the water supply for seven states that depend heavily on the Colorado River.
A Deepening Water Emergency
As of now, Lake Powell’s water levels have plummeted to figures not witnessed since 1957. This historic low has raised serious concerns about the sustainability of water resources in the region, which has been grappling with severe drought conditions exacerbated by climate change. The Colorado River system, which supplies water to approximately 40 million people, is under unprecedented stress, forcing states to reconsider their water management strategies and policies.
The U.S. Bureau of Reclamation recently reported that the water levels in both Lake Powell and Lake Mead are alarmingly low, prompting urgent discussions among state leaders about potential cuts to water allocations. The implications of these reductions could be severe, affecting agriculture, urban areas, and ecosystems alike.
The Stakes for Seven States
The seven states—Arizona, California, Colorado, Nevada, New Mexico, Utah, and Wyoming—draw from the Colorado River system, and they are now facing the potential of drastic shortages. The repercussions of these dwindling supply levels extend beyond immediate water availability; they threaten agricultural production, which relies heavily on consistent water supplies for irrigation.
Experts believe that without immediate action to mitigate the ongoing crisis, the situation will only worsen. State officials are being urged to collaborate on innovative solutions, including investing in water conservation technologies and revising water-sharing agreements to ensure equitable distribution among the states.
Climate Change’s Role in the Crisis
The root causes of this crisis are deeply intertwined with climate change. Rising temperatures have led to increased evaporation rates and altered precipitation patterns, resulting in diminished snowpack levels in the Rocky Mountains—the primary source of water for the Colorado River. As climate models project more extreme weather conditions, water scarcity may become the new norm for the region.
Activists and environmentalists are calling for a shift in how the states manage their water resources, advocating for sustainable practices that prioritise conservation and resilience. They argue that a more proactive approach is critical to safeguarding the future of the Colorado River and the millions who rely on it.
